In 2017, the electronic cigarette market saw JUUL dominate its competitors, becoming the top-selling E-CIGS in the U.S. with nearly 60% market share. This shift marked a transition from the "big cloud" market to the "pod market," where various pod products emerged and flourished.
Originating from the initial pod systems, electronic cigarettes have evolved through innovations in atomizers and high-power devices, and now pods are making a strong comeback. The pod market caters to a wide range of smokers, offering significant potential in terms of flavor, portability, and cost-effectiveness. The rise of electronic cigarettes is undeniable. Pods are designed to mimic the size of traditional cigarettes, typically featuring two characteristics: an integrated structure with a draw-activated switch and an LED light at the end of the device. The draw-activated switch means that when you inhale through the mouthpiece, the atomizer and battery activate automatically, eliminating the need for a button. Advantages of Pod Systems
Pod systems are convenient for on-the-go use, compact and portable, with vapor volume considering various usage restrictions; disposable pod systems allow users to simply "pop" the pod onto the battery and start vaping; pod devices have evolved with an increasing variety of flavor options and improved pod airtightness; moreover, for tobacco companies, pod products offer greater closure and higher user retention. Most pod systems only support their brand's pods/e-liquids/accessories.
